armistice

armistice

noun ar-mees-TEES Rare

Origin: from Latin armistitium

Usage Note

Armistice refers to a formal agreement to stop fighting. In France, le 11 Novembre (Armistice Day) commemorates the end of World War I in 1918 and is a public holiday. The word is masculine despite ending in -e, which trips up many learners.

Examples

"L'armistice fut signé le 11 novembre."

Natural Translation

The armistice was signed on 11 November.
